Wood siding service encompasses a variety of treatments and repairs aimed at maintaining the appearance and integrity of wooden exterior walls. These services often include cleaning, sanding, staining, sealing, and repainting to protect wood surfaces from weather elements such as moisture, sunlight, and temperature fluctuations. Proper maintenance can help prevent issues like wood rot, warping, and insect infestation, ensuring the siding remains durable and visually appealing over time. Professionals may also perform repairs to replace damaged or decayed sections, restoring the structural stability and aesthetic of the property.

The primary problems addressed by wood siding services involve deterioration caused by exposure to the elements and biological factors. Over time, wood siding can develop cracks, peeling paint, or mold growth, which compromise its protective qualities. Without proper upkeep, these issues can lead to more extensive damage, including wood rot that may threaten the structural integrity of the exterior walls. Wood siding services help mitigate these problems by restoring the surface, applying protective coatings, and ensuring the siding remains resistant to future damage, thereby extending its lifespan.

Cost Range for Wood Siding Installation - The typical cost for installing new wood siding varies from approximately $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the project and siding type. Larger homes or high-end materials can push costs higher. Local service providers can provide precise estimates based on specific needs.

Cost Range for Wood Siding Repair - Repair costs generally range from $300 to $2,500, influenced by the extent of damage and the number of sections needing work. Minor repairs tend to be on the lower end, while extensive damage can increase expenses. Contact local pros for detailed quotes.

Cost Range for Wood Siding Replacement - Replacing wood siding typically costs between $7,000 and $20,000, varying with the size of the property and siding style. Premium materials or complex installations may result in higher costs. Local contractors can assess and provide accurate pricing.

Cost Range for Siding Maintenance - Maintenance services, including cleaning and sealing, usually range from $200 to $800 per session. Regular upkeep helps preserve the appearance and integrity of wood siding. Service providers can offer tailored maintenance plans and pricing est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ood siding services are available? Local service providers offer installation, repair, and replacement of various wood siding styles, including clapboard, shingles, and board-and-batten.

How can I tell if my wood siding needs repair? Signs include warping, cracking, rotting, or pest damage. A professional inspection can determine if repairs or replacement are necessary.

What are common wood siding maintenance tasks? Maintenance typically involves cleaning, staining or sealing, and addressing any damage to preserve the siding's appearance and durability.

Are there different wood siding materials to choose from? Yes, options include cedar, redwood, pine, and treated wood, each offering different aesthetics and durability levels.

How long does wood siding typically last? With proper maintenance, wood siding can last 20 to 40 years, depending on the climate and care practices.
